On December 20, 2020, the league temporarily realigned into four divisions with no conferences due to the COVID-19 pandemic and the ongoing closure of the Canada–United States border.
The Stars experienced a COVID-19 outbreak during training camp, with 17 team members testing positive.
[1] The Stars finally began the season on a high note eight days late on January 22, 2021, with a 7–0 rout of the Nashville Predators.
Below are the Dallas Stars' selections at the 2020 NHL Entry Draft, which was originally scheduled for June 26–27, 2020 at the Bell Center in Montreal, Quebec, but was postponed on March 25, 2020, due to the COVID-19 pandemic.
It was instead held on October 6–7, 2020, virtually via video conference call from the NHL Network studio in Secaucus, New Jersey.
